Garblers

/ɡɑrblərz/ noun

Definition

Plural of garbler; multiple people who garble or distort information.

Etymology

Regular plural formation of 'garbler' by adding '-s.' See 'garbler' for etymology.

Kelly Says

Medieval merchants had official 'garblers'—people whose job was to inspect spices and goods to catch fraudulent dealers who mixed inferior products with quality goods!
